How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Park View?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Park View Studio Apartments | $1,042 | $600 | $1,329 |
| Park View 1 Bedroom Apartments | $969 | $600 | $1,700 |
| Park View 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,136 | $730 | $2,090 |
| Park View 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,842 | $940 | $4,990 |
| Park View 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,391 | $2,025 | $2,895 |

Largest Available Park View and Nearby Studio Apartments
The largest available Studio apartment unit in Park View, IA is found at Candlelight Court in the Vander Veer Park neighborhood and is 650 square feet priced from $600. Authentix Bettendorf in the Outer Davenport Bettendorf neighborhood has the second largest Studio, which is sized at 622 square feet and currently listed start at $1,319. Here is today’s list of the largest available Studio units in Park View: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Candlelight Court | Studio | 650 Sq Ft | $600 |
| Authentix Bettendorf | Studio Premier Retreat Overloo | 622 Sq Ft | $1,319 |
| Springs at Bettendorf Apartments | Studio Grand Overlook | 616 Sq Ft | $1,045 |
| The Jade on Tremont | Opal | 540 Sq Ft | $1,195 |
| The Groves on Devils Glen | Studio with Private Garage | 518 Sq Ft | $1,250 |
Cheapest Available Park View and Nearby Studio Apartments
As of April 12, 2026 the lowest priced Studio apartment unit in Park View, IA is the Studio Model starting from $600 at Candlelight Court in the Vander Veer Park neighborhood. The second most affordable Park View Studio is the 0BR/1.0BA Model at Woodland Apartments starting at $695 . The average price for all Studio apartments in Park View is currently $1,042.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available Studio options in Park View: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Candlelight Court | Studio | $600 |
| Woodland Apartments | 0BR/1.0BA | $695 |
| Williamsburg Apartments | Studio | $700 |
| Village at Sheridan Meadows | Studio - Phase 2 | $750 |
| Iowa Mutual Lofts | Studio | $850 |
